{BBQ Wood Pellets 101: Types & Flavors & How to Choose
Venturing into the world of BBQ cooking? Familiarizing yourself with wood pellets is essential for achieving that authentic smoky flavor. These compacted blocks of lumber aren't all the identical ; different varieties impart unique flavors to your meats . Common options include hickory , known for their strong flavors, Wood pellets applewood , which offer a sweeter taste, and birch, providing a more understated aroma. When choosing pellets, think about the type of meat you’re grilling and the flavor profile you’re trying to achieve . Furthermore , ensure pellets that are pure wood and free from additives for the optimal flavor.

Your Complete Guide You Should Know About Oak Lumber Pellets for Smoking
Oak pellets are a favored selection for achieving a rich taste to your meat . Sourced from oak timber, these small pieces of fuel burn fairly hotly , producing a distinct woodsy fragrance. They impart a hearty essence that pairs well with beef , poultry , and even certain vegetables .
- Keep in mind that oak burns a stronger smoke aroma than milder woods .
- When a more delicate smoke , try combining oak fuel with fruit or cherry briquettes.
- Be sure to source your oak fuel from a reputable vendor to ensure optimal burning .
